The Transportation Cabinet is Eager to “ADOPT” Your Student’s Ideas! - Adopt-A-Highway Poster Contest Deadline September 30, 2005
Each year the Kentucky Transportation Cabinet hosts a contest to allow students from across the Commonwealth to submit their creative works for use in the annual Adopt-A-Highway Calendar. Exposure to the contest and to the Adopt-A-Highway program provides our young people with a sense of ownership in Kentucky’s highways and stresses the importance of keeping our highways clean and free of litter. It’s our way of educating our children not to litter and encouraging them to spread the message to others.
